Asia stocks cautiously higher amid conflicting signals on Iran de-escalation

Asian stocks are reportedly moving higher with some cautious optimism as tensions over Iran appear to show signs of de-escalation. However, conflicting signals regarding the geopolitical situation may impact investor sentiment and market stability. Major indexes in Japan and Hong Kong gained ground, reflecting a slight bullish trend. Investors are closely monitoring energy prices and potential sanctions, which could affect commodities. Overall market reactions suggest a wait-and-see approach is prevailing among traders.

Stocks Sink in Broad AI Rout Sparked by China's DeepSeek

U.S. stocks experienced a significant downturn, primarily driven by a broad sell-off in artificial intelligence (AI) related companies. The Nasdaq index led these declines, with many AI infrastructure providers suffering steep, double-digit percentage falls. This market rout was reportedly initiated by developments concerning China's DeepSeek. A prominent example of the impact was Nvidia, whose stock price dropped by a substantial 16%. The overall market sentiment turned bearish, especially for the technology sector heavily reliant on AI innovation.

Israel expands attacks to Iranian oil storage facilities

Israel has significantly escalated the ongoing Middle East conflict by expanding its attacks to include Iranian oil storage facilities. In direct retaliation, Iran has targeted critical infrastructure within Bahrain and Kuwait. This marks a dangerous new phase, as both sides are now striking key energy assets and national infrastructure. The widening scope of the conflict to include major oil-producing nations' facilities suggests a significant increase in regional instability. This escalation is poised to have substantial global economic repercussions, particularly for energy markets.

U.S. orders staff to leave Saudi Arabia as Iran war spreads and oil surges above $110

The U.S. has ordered non-emergency government staff to leave Saudi Arabia, signaling escalating tensions in the region. This directive comes as the Iran war reportedly spreads, intensifying geopolitical instability. Global markets reacted sharply to the news, particularly in the energy sector. Oil prices surged above $110 per barrel, reflecting heightened supply concerns and risk premiums. This development suggests significant economic ripple effects and increased market uncertainty.
